  • @Dexduzdiz The numark mixtrack has no built in sound cards (audio outputs) so you need to buy an external one and plug it in. You want to have it connected up via USB and then change the sound card settings in the software to set your new sound card as master. You can then set your computers sound card for cueing

  • @dubstepdrop94 All audio signals need to be amplified before they are connected to speakers. There are two options. You either go from your audio source/mixer into an amplifier that then connects to your speakers. Or you can get active speakers where the amplifier is built into the speakers. This is the case with most computer speakers. You don't have a seperate amplifier unit.

  • @Mszzimported All the sound is outputted through the rear RCA (phono) outputs on the back of the mixtrack pro. To change your sound card settings to play through your computer speakers you will need to pay to upgrade the software and then you can change the sound card settings. Or you can just buy a phono to 2.5mm socket and then connect your speakers to the phono outputs
